Martin Luther King's Lasting Legacy on Equity and Social Movements

WNYC held its 10th annual Martin Luther King Jr. Day celebration at the Apollo Theater this weekend, co-hosted by WNYC hosts Jami Floyd and Brian Lehrer.
Presented as part of the Apollo Uptown Hall series, this year's event focused on disparity in America by looking at the impact of institutional racism while exploring race and privilege.
Hear an excerpt from our #WNYCMLK event: a panel discussion about equity, social movements, and justice with the following guests:
- Rinku Sen: executive director of Race Forward
- Sheena Wright: chief executive officer of United Way of Greater New York City
- Janai Nelson: Associate Director-Counsel of the NAACP Legal Defense and Education Fund
